Somebody run down to the Golden Nugget on Fremont, sign up for the players club and count the rotations and time when you spin the reels!


Wrong machine. That is a Colossal Slot, not a Big Bertha. Big Bertha has much smaller reels. http://www.nypartydivision.com/item_pictures/FGL_bertha.jpg

There are videos on youtube of the Golden Nugget machine. I watched them and guessed 30 rpms as they look like about one revolution every two seconds.

Now I never would have guessed the Bally Big Bertha is 100 rpms! That's 1.666 revolutions per second!!!! Wow!! But that's what it says so I guess that's it. No wonder the stops broke!!!
